METHOD 8151/8151A - CHLORINATED HERBICIDES
          Method 8151 is applicable for the determination of chlorinated herbicides by GC, using methylation or pentafluorobenzylation derivitization,
          by capillary column technique.


          Method 8151A is applicable for determination of chlorinated herbicides by GC using methylation or pentafluorobenzylation derivatization.
          This method utilizes a capillary column technique with the GC
